Lushly Toned 1814 Half Dollar MS64
1814 50C MS64 PCGS. O-105, R.2. Deep ocean-blue and plum-red toning envelops this satiny Capped Bust half. The strike is precise aside from the right-side star centers and minor incompleteness on the eagle's right (facing) claw. The dies are boldly clashed, as usual for this Overton marriage. Population: 25 in 64, 10 finer (8/07).(Registry values: N2998)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 24F3, PCGS# 6105, GSID# 6154)
Metal: 89.24% Silver, 10.76% Copper
Weight: 13.48 grams
ASW: 0.38676oz
Mintage: 1,000,000
